***Fire Alarm Technician***

An established and innovative company is seeking a professional, self-motivated Fire Alarm Technician to join their team. This is an opportunity for a Fire Alarm Technician to become an integral part to a team who values integrity and rewards dedication and innovation.

Fire Alarm Technician Duties:

* Install, program, configure, commission, maintain, trouble shoot, perform diagnostics, and repairs of fire alarm systems and related wiring and equipment.
* Ensure compliance with NFPA, including performing annual device testing for fire alarm systems and complete and maintain all records required by NFPA-72.
* Excellent customer service and verbal skills.

Fire Alarm Technician Qualifications:

* Experience in the Fire Alarm/Fire Protection Industry.
* MS Office Applications
* Ability to multitask and prioritize duties
* Effective communication skills
* Motivated self-starter
* Excellent critical thinking skills
* Must possess a valid driver's license & clean driving record
* NICET is a plus
